Two crises at sea
Products are having difficulty getting to their destinations around the world
because of twin crises on the high seas that have simultaneously bogged down
global commerce.
For six days, Egypt's Suez Canal was blocked by a giant cargo vessel that got
stuck and held up hundreds of other ships on a route that handles about 12%
of world trade. The Ever Given — about as long as the Empire State Building
is tall — was finally freed Monday, but analysts say it could take more than
a week to clear the backup.
Meanwhile, a shortage of shipping containers also is causing problems in the
cargo transport industry. Many of the factories that build the giant metal
boxes are in China — and a number of them shut down in the early days of the
COVID crisis, cutting supplies short.
The companies that produce the containers were caught off guard as
international trade started to rebound from the pandemic during the second
half of 2020. A wide range of things, including cars, clothing, toys and raw
materials, ship in the containers, so manufacturers are having difficulty
getting their goods to market.
Which products will be affected?
Grocery prices were already rising faster than inflation. Now, shortages
related to the shipping troubles could push up prices for an array of items —
and force you to find creative ways to save.
Given the situation in the Suez Canal and the container crunch, several types
of products could become harder to find before long.
1. Toilet paper
One of the companies impacted by the container crisis is Suzano SA. The
Brazilian company is the world’s largest producer of wood pulp, used to make
toilet paper, and it's warning that the lack of containers could slow
shipments to its production partners.
Suzano CEO Walter Schalka told Bloomberg his company shipped less product in
March than anticipated and has been forced to delay some shipments into
April. A global shortage is possible.

2. Furniture
Deliveries of furniture are being affected by the shipping industry issues.
La-Z-Boy recently said on an earnings call that customers can expect to wait
for their new sofas and chairs anywhere from five to nine months after
placing their orders.
Congestion at ports in Southern California, where many containers from Asia
arrive, has been an issue for months.
And the Suez shutdown held up shipments of furniture from Ikea, which is
based in Sweden. "The blockage of the Suez Canal is an additional constraint
to an already challenging and volatile situation for global supply chains
brought on by the pandemic," Ikea said in a statement.
3. Cheese
The wholesale club chain Costco recently blamed a shortage of imported cheese
on the shipping container shortfall. The retailer cited issues at ports along
the West Coast, from Seattle down through California.
"Overseas freight has continued to be an issue in regards to container
shortage and port delays," Costco chief financial officer Richard Galanti
told analysts on a call in March. "This has caused timing delays on certain
categories."
Galanti said Costco also has had trouble keeping its giant stores stocked
with furniture, sporting goods and lawn equipment, in addition to other
imported food items like seafood and olive oils.
4. Coffee
The Suez Canal blockage has stalled some shipments of coffee, specifically
the type used to make instant coffee like Nescafe.
The Suez is a major shipping route from Vietnam — the world’s largest
producer of robusta coffee, used in instant coffee — so a scarcity of beans
could soon be felt at coffee shops and in supermarkets.
